In the late 70s and 80s there was a revitalization of the city. The inner harbor was made for shopping and restaurants. The aquarium and science center. Balto had houses for 1 dollar, and you had to put 10,000 into repairs. It was called charm city. Lot of places for visitors. Walter's Art Museum, Fort McHenry, Edgar Allen Poe house., Baltimore Zoo....etc. All of my family was in Baltimore, but they have all left Balto. I'm in Tennessee.
